TitleJustice and Peace Programme small grants: 2001/2002
LevelFile
Date2000 - 2003
DescriptionGrant file containing correspondence, agendas, business plan, annual reports and accounts, greetings cards, project proposals, grant overviews and funding requests relating to Justice and Peace Programme small grants for 2001/2002. Funding source(s): Barrow Cadbury Trust, Barrow Cadbury Fund Ltd. Applicant overview: This file contains a series of small grants made on the recommendation of Justice and Peace Relevant Trustees for the year 2001/2002 out of the Trust and Fund small grants budget. Nature of support: Grants were made to College of Ripon and York; Iowa University of Science and Technology; Ligoniel Family Centre, Belfast; New Life Counselling Service, Ardoyne, Belfast; Tanbridge House School, Horsham; United Nations Association International Service; West Midlands Peace Education Project; Cavancarragh Community Association, County Fermanagh; Cooneen Amateur Boxing Club, County Fermanagh; Dooneen Community Education Centre; Grave Maintain; Recy Women's Group, Belfast and Windows for Sudan. Other small grants were made to Edith Cadbury Nursery School, Weoley Castle; Hallfield Junior School, London and the MDCC Theatre Company, Birmingham. Grant totals range between £500 and £3,000. Minutes: BCT 989, BCF 3692. Notes: Copy minutes are not included through minutes are referenced in the grant overviews. File indexed and organised by applicant.
